Decoding Antarctica’s Meltdown: Key Insights on the Ice Sheet’s Future

The article explores the complex dynamics behind the melting of Antarctica’s massive ice sheet, which holds enough freshwater to raise global sea levels significantly. Scientists are now gaining deeper insights into these processes, emphasizing the role of warming ocean currents, ice-ocean interactions, and the impact of climate change. This growing understanding is critical for predicting future sea level rise and developing strategies to mitigate its consequences globally.
